Output 6548a069e5f6dea3eb2aa67604393060602539e9d38d3f12e0094601bd07a083:7

value
590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a0e4a086e021aeed50aaf44bfff5fb190fcb63b OP_EQUAL
address
3HCBuz6uPuEk7ufzytHUGdCw9y8dQWSQqk
transaction
6548a069e5f6dea3eb2aa67604393060602539e9d38d3f12e0094601bd07a083
spent
true